public interface ParameterableElement extends Element
The following features are supported:
PivotPackage.getParameterableElement()
Modifier and Type | Method and Description |
---|---|
TemplateParameter |
getOwningTemplateParameter()
Returns the value of the 'Owning Template Parameter' container reference.
|
TemplateParameter |
getTemplateParameter()
Returns the value of the 'Template Parameter' reference.
|
boolean |
isCompatibleWith(ParameterableElement p) |
boolean |
isTemplateParameter()
The query isTemplateParameter() determines if this parameterable element is exposed as a formal template parameter.
|
void |
setOwningTemplateParameter(TemplateParameter value)
Sets the value of the '
Owning Template Parameter ' container reference. |
void |
setTemplateParameter(TemplateParameter value)
Sets the value of the '
Template Parameter ' reference. |
allOwnedElements, createExtension, createOwnedComment, getETarget, getExtension, getOwnedComment, getValue
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
TemplateParameter getTemplateParameter()
Parametered Element
'.
The template parameter that exposes this element as a formal parameter.
setTemplateParameter(TemplateParameter)
,
PivotPackage.getParameterableElement_TemplateParameter()
,
TemplateParameter.getParameteredElement()
void setTemplateParameter(TemplateParameter value)
Template Parameter
' reference.
value
- the new value of the 'Template Parameter' reference.getTemplateParameter()
TemplateParameter getOwningTemplateParameter()
Owned Parametered Element
'.
This feature subsets the following features:
The formal template parameter that owns this element.setOwningTemplateParameter(TemplateParameter)
,
PivotPackage.getParameterableElement_OwningTemplateParameter()
,
TemplateParameter.getOwnedParameteredElement()
void setOwningTemplateParameter(TemplateParameter value)
Owning Template Parameter
' container reference.
value
- the new value of the 'Owning Template Parameter' container reference.getOwningTemplateParameter()
boolean isTemplateParameter()
boolean isCompatibleWith(ParameterableElement p)